step one A valuable asset depending otherwise asset depletion loan is the one in the that financial investigates possessions, versus. loans Addison acquired earnings, so you can qualify for a mortgage. A standard experience when deciding to take the monetary possessions, and you will divide of the 120 months (i.age. a decade). This is the imputed “income”, right after which its regularly measure the debt in order to income ratio.

$dos billion into the assets. Separate by 120 = $16,667. Multiply by the 43% financial obligation in order to earnings ratio, along with $eight,167. That should safety homeloan payment, PMI (if appropriate), home insurance, assets taxation, and all almost every other personal debt. While no other loans, homeowner’s insurance coverage regarding $400 a month, assets taxation out of $600 1 month, without PMI, you to actually leaves $6,167 getting a home loan payment. At the step 3.5% focus, which is an excellent a good $step one,373,000 mortgage, so with 20% off which is a beneficial $step one.71M household.
